Ed25519ph Sign and Verify
See more Ed25519 Examples
Demonstrates how to create an Ed25519ph signature, and then to verify it.Note: This example requires Chilkat v9.5.0.91 or greater.

program ChilkatDemo;
// Demonstrates using the Chilkat Pascal wrapper via the C bridge DLL.
// Builds as a console application under Lazarus (FPC) or Delphi.
{$IFDEF FPC}
{$MODE DELPHI}
{$ENDIF}
{$APPTYPE CONSOLE}
uses
{$IFDEF UNIX}
cthreads,
{$ENDIF}
SysUtils,
CkDllLoader,
Chilkat.EdDSA,
Chilkat.BinData,
Chilkat.PrivateKey,
Chilkat.PublicKey;
// ---------------------------------------------------------------------------
procedure RunDemo;
var
success: Boolean;
privKeyHex: string;
pubKeyHex: string;
privKey: TPrivateKey;
bd: TBinData;
eddsa: TEdDSA;
hexSig: string;
pubKey: TPublicKey;
bVerified: Boolean;
begin
success := False;
// This example assumes the Chilkat API to have been previously unlocked.
// See Global Unlock Sample for sample code.
// Use the following test vector from https://www.rfc-editor.org/rfc/rfc8032#page-30
// -----TEST abc
//
// ALGORITHM:
// Ed25519ph
//
// SECRET KEY:
// 833fe62409237b9d62ec77587520911e
// 9a759cec1d19755b7da901b96dca3d42
//
// PUBLIC KEY:
// ec172b93ad5e563bf4932c70e1245034
// c35467ef2efd4d64ebf819683467e2bf
//
// MESSAGE (length 3 bytes):
// 616263
//
// SIGNATURE:
// 98a70222f0b8121aa9d30f813d683f80
// 9e462b469c7ff87639499bb94e6dae41
// 31f85042463c2a355a2003d062adf5aa
// a10b8c61e636062aaad11c2a26083406
privKeyHex := '833fe62409237b9d62ec77587520911e9a759cec1d19755b7da901b96dca3d42';
pubKeyHex := 'ec172b93ad5e563bf4932c70e1245034c35467ef2efd4d64ebf819683467e2bf';
privKey := TPrivateKey.Create;
success := privKey.LoadEd25519(privKeyHex,pubKeyHex);
if (success = False) then
begin
WriteLn(privKey.LastErrorText);
Exit;
end;
// The data to be signed...
bd := TBinData.Create;
bd.AppendEncoded('616263','hex');
eddsa := TEdDSA.Create;
// Indicate we want the Ed25519ph instance.
eddsa.Algorithm := 'Ed25519ph';
hexSig := eddsa.SignBdENC(bd,'hexlower',privKey);
WriteLn('signature = ' + hexSig);
// The expected output is: 98a70222f0b8121aa9d30f813d683f80....
// Verify the signature..
pubKey := TPublicKey.Create;
success := pubKey.LoadEd25519(pubKeyHex);
if (success = False) then
begin
WriteLn(pubKey.LastErrorText);
Exit;
end;
bVerified := eddsa.VerifyBdENC(bd,hexSig,'hexlower',pubKey);
if (bVerified = False) then
begin
WriteLn(eddsa.LastErrorText);
WriteLn('Failed to verify the signature.');
Exit;
end;
WriteLn('The Ed25519ph signature is verified!');
privKey.Free;
bd.Free;
eddsa.Free;
pubKey.Free;
end;
// ---------------------------------------------------------------------------
begin
try
RunDemo;
except
on E: Exception do
WriteLn('Unhandled exception: ', E.ClassName, ': ', E.Message);
end;
WriteLn;
{$IFDEF MSWINDOWS}
WriteLn('Press Enter to exit...');
ReadLn;
{$ENDIF}
end.
